As the continuance of our series study on LiCoO2 surface modification, the complicated traditional surface coating method is replaced with simple addition of amorphous YPO4 and Al2O3 in commercial LiCoO2 or in commercial electrolyte based on our understanding to the improvement mechanism of surface modification. Comprehensive studies by X-ray photoelectron spectroscopy (XPS), gas chromatography and mass spectroscopy (GC–MS), inductively coupled plasma (ICP) and Fourier transformed infrared (FTIR) indicate that the products of spontaneous reaction between the additive and the LiPF6 based electrolyte are responsible for the performance improvements.  相似文献

以丙烯酰胺、丙烯酰氧基乙基三甲基氯化铵、聚氧乙烯大单体和N ,N’ -亚甲基双丙烯酰胺为单体 ,进行四元反相微乳液共聚合 ,制备出新型含PEO支链的阳离子微粒絮凝剂。然后用该微粒絮凝剂分别对针叶木纸浆和特种纸白水进行了助留和絮凝性能的研究 ,结果表明 ,本新型微粒具有能单独使用、絮凝效果好和抗剪切性强等优点。  相似文献

Attenuations of the first (or fundamental) longitudinal guided wave modes propagating in liquid-filled steel pipes are numerically investigated. Several filling liquids transported by the steel pipe are considered in the investigation. In the numerical modeling stage, a sink is considered for abandoning standing wave modes caused by the internal liquids; hence, the attenuation dispersion curves become simpler. From the attenuation dispersion curves, two specific attenuation values corresponding to 1 MHz and 2.68 MHz are selected; then, the concept of parametric density is introduced to predict attenuation for a certain filling material. With this concept, it is possible to approximately calculate attenuation values without a complex numerical attenuation calculation. This investigation may provide fundamental data to inspectors using ultrasonic guided-wave techniques in the petrochemical industry and in the field of water supply, two branches of the economy that are always under pressure owing to the demand of increasing productivity and that are challenged owing to stricter environmental rules, thus necessitating promising, low-cost inspection techniques. 本文采用反相微乳液聚合的方法合成了丙烯酰胺(AM)/丙烯酰氧基乙基三甲基氯化铵(AD-AMQUAT)/聚氧乙烯大单体(PEO-A)/N,N'-亚甲基双丙烯酰胺(Bis)的四元共聚物微粒.研究了该微粒助留剂的结构与性能.这种微粒和纸纤维能够通过离子键和氢键作用显著地增强助留效果.  相似文献

YAG:Ce Phosphors for WLED via Nano-Pesudoboehmite Sol-Gel Route   总被引:5,自引:0,他引:5  
The sub-micron sized YAG : Ce phosphors were synthesized via a modified sol-gel method by peptizing nano-pesudoboehmite particulate. It is found that YAG phase from the dried gel powders appears at 1000 ℃ then the pure YAG phase exists at a relatively lower sintering temperature of 1400 ℃. The smaller sizes of phosphors in the ranges of 1 - 3 μm are obtained due to the contribution of seeding effects of nano-sized alumina particles to strengthen each step of the processes. Both the excitation and emission spectra of photoluminescence of the phosphor obtained at 1400 ℃ meet well with the spectroscopic requirements of the WLED phosphors.  相似文献

The instability curve of a Rijke tube system was obtained accurately by following different paths of heat power and flow-rate for three regions and by defining its locus from the criterion based on the measured sound pressure levels. The unstable limits in the region of flow-rate lower than that at the minimal power are compared with previous data. To observe the effect of turbulence on the unstable limits, inflow turbulence was introduced by placing a bundle of circular cylinders upstream of the heating part (50< Red< 700). The large-amplitude inflow fluctuation may delay the transition of the chamber acoustic mode to the unstable zone even at a sufficient power.  相似文献

6to4与ISATAP技术相结合的IPv6网络实现   总被引:2,自引:0,他引:2  
在IPv4向IPv6过渡期间,多种过渡技术可以互相支持、互相组合使用,以达到互利互助。简要介绍了其中2种隧道技术:6to4技术和ISATAP技术,提出了1种基于两者结合的新型实验网络的实现方案。具体讨论了在Linux下如何组建这种新型实验网络平台,详细阐明了如何配置IPv6主机以及双栈路由器,为IPv4过渡到IPv6提供1个可行的方案。  相似文献

In this work, the collapse moment due to wall-thinned defects is estimated through fuzzy model identification. A subtractive clustering method is used as the basis of a fast and robust algorithm for identifying the fuzzy model. The fuzzy model is optimized by a genetic algorithm combined with a least squares method. The developed fuzzy model has been applied to the numerical data obtained from the finite element analysis. Principal component analysis is used to preprocess the input signals into the fuzzy model to reduce the sensitivity to the input change and the fuzzy model are trained by using the data set prepared for training (training data) and verified by using another data set different (independent) from the training data. Also, three fuzzy models are trained, respectively, for three data sets divided into the three classes of extrados, intrados, and crown defects, which is because they have different characteristics. The relative root mean square (RMS) errors of the estimated collapse moment are 0.5397% for the training data and 0.8673% for the test data. It is known from this result that the fuzzy models are sufficiently accurate to be used in the integrity evaluation of wall-thinned pipe bends and elbows.  相似文献

为了保持油井稳产,提高油藏采收率,姬塬油区拟采用面积法注水,急需对油藏分布规律进行详实、系统的研究,以保证井网建设的合理、高效。在前人研究成果基础上,对油区现有测井资料进行收集、整理、再解释,从油藏特征研究出发,对储集层进行测井分析,并使用克里金技术进行了地质建模。使用容积法计算油藏储量,为油区的注水开发提供了油藏资料。  相似文献
